Which report type is typically associated with integrating Adaptive Planning data for external presentations?

Model Reports are specifically designed for use within the context of Workday Adaptive Planning, and they allow users to create dynamic reports that reflect the most current data from their planning models. These reports are versatile and can incorporate data from various dimensions and metrics, providing detailed insights that are essential for decision-making.

When it comes to integrating Adaptive Planning data for external presentations, the comprehensive nature of Model Reports makes them particularly effective. They enable users to tailor the report to include only relevant data, ensuring that stakeholders receive clear and focused information that can be easily understood in a presentation setting. This customization is important for effective communication of planning insights to external parties.

In contrast, options like Matrix Reports are used for comparative views of data in a grid format, Snapshot Reports capture specific data points at a given moment but may lack the dynamic capabilities needed for presenting the most current information, and Web Reports provide online access but may not be as tailored or feature-rich as Model Reports for the purpose of integration into presentations. Therefore, the functionality and flexibility of Model Reports make them the ideal choice for this context.
